Transaction 70fa65bd454dbd3d03dbcf2d142251f693194d22a864f914986781510ed03bfc
2 Input
2 Outputs
- 70fa65bd454dbd3d03dbcf2d142251f693194d22a864f914986781510ed03bfc:0
- 70fa65bd454dbd3d03dbcf2d142251f693194d22a864f914986781510ed03bfc:1
value 59900000
address 1g4Attv416tnmFbHRhtACL1pmBxAKP8ot
value 6139423
address 1DLLuYY7MyvfrgvkgMGWXmuUz8Zciw3Rsm